Output 6291c67028521e444ab7630fb0edf14bb402968e9798a774d92b998f659cac06:1

value
424000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dc703f5ef021a59afba1017e609702fbf28c024 OP_EQUALVERIFY OP_CHECKSIG
address
186FScHNFGiJFPpp1b3ZLmiCxWcL3qbwar
transaction
6291c67028521e444ab7630fb0edf14bb402968e9798a774d92b998f659cac06
spent
true